    Need a Rod suggestion

    My Father in -Law gave me a Penn TRQ300 as a thank you for taking care of his dog, Does anybody have a rod suggestion that they really like comboed to it. It will catch mostly school Bluefins Albies, Bonita and shark, possibly yellowfin if the weather cooperates this year for me. Also what line would you rec the 30 Mono or an 80 braid that it is rated for? To me the 80 braid seems a bit much but you all are more experienced then me, opinions appreciated

    I'd line it with 80lb hollowcore, so you can have wind on topshots, no knots exposed. I'd match it with a 6'6" Trevala rod from Shimano TVC66H. A 6'6" rod will give you more action then a 6' rod. A 6' rod may be better if you will not be jigging all the time. I've used this exact setup to put 80+lb yellowfin's in the boat both jigging and chunking. The jig rods are super fun and do not wear the angler out.
